NVD · unedited
Requarks Wiki.js 2.5.307 does not properly revoke or invalidate active JWT tokens when a user logs out. As a result, previously issued tokens remain valid and can be reused to access the system, even after logout. This behavior affects session integrity and may allow unauthorized access if a token is compromised. The issue is present in the authentication resolver logic and affects both the GraphQL endpoint and the logout mechanism.

Wiki.js 2.5.307 fails to revoke or invalidate active JWT tokens upon user logout. The authentication resolver logic does not implement proper token invalidation, allowing previously issued tokens to remain valid indefinitely even after the user has logged out. This enables session hijacking and unauthorized access if a token is intercepted or leaked.

MitigationImplement server-side token blacklisting or revocation mechanism in the logout flow and authentication resolver to invalidate active JWT tokens upon logout. Consider adding short expiration times and implementing token refresh rotation.

Work through these to decide whether this CVE applies to you.

  1. Check installed Wiki.js version
    Run `node -e "console.log(require('./package.json').version)"` in the Wiki.js installation directory, or check the version displayed in the admin panel under System Info.
    Affected if The installed version is exactly 2.5.307.
  2. Verify JWT is used for authentication
    Check the authentication configuration in the Wiki.js admin panel or inspect the config.yml file for auth strategies that issue JWT tokens (such as local, LDAP, or OAuth).
    Affected if JWT-based authentication is enabled and active.
  3. Test token invalidation after logout
    Log in with a user account, capture the JWT token from browser storage or API response, then log out. Attempt to use the same token in an API request (e.g., `curl -H "Authorization: Bearer <token>" <wiki-url>/api/`).
    Affected if The token remains valid and grants access after logout (token is NOT invalidated).
  4. Inspect authentication resolver code
    Examine the source file handling the logout endpoint and authentication resolution (typically in the `server/modules/auth/` directory). Look for any token blacklist, revocation list, or database query that invalidates the token on logout.
    Affected if No token invalidation or blacklist mechanism exists in the logout flow.

You are affected if you run Wiki.js version 2.5.307 and find that JWT tokens remain functional after a user logs out, indicating missing token revocation logic.
